Agria Processing Potato Demand

Agria processing potato demand measures processor pull for specification-ready Agria supply in European fry markets. Buyers can compare dry matter, color, storage cohorts, regional availability, and substitute economics before accepting a variety premium.

Market Data

How to read this market

Agria processing-demand data measures processor pull relative to contracted acreage, plant nominations, storage inventory, spot availability, and approved substitutes in European fry markets. The market object is specification-ready Agria supply where dry matter, fry color, shape, recovery, and storage performance determine plant value.

Use the data to separate broad competition for Agria from a localized quality or storage problem. Compare regional crop conditions, storage cohorts, plant requirements, and substitute varieties such as other approved fry potatoes before accepting a premium.

Why this matters

Agria demand can strengthen while overall European processing supply looks balanced because usable dry matter, color, and storage condition narrow the eligible pool.

Commercial interpretation should identify whether the constraint is variety-specific or simply a local storage-quality issue. Substitution economics determine whether an Agria premium represents true scarcity.

Overview

Who is this for?

This page is for fry processors, procurement teams, growers, and market analysts that need to understand demand for Agria potatoes. Agria is widely valued in European processing markets for dry matter, fry color, shape, storage behavior, and suitability for fries and other products, but demand is not uniform across plants, regions, or crop years. MassGain connects variety-specific processor pull with contracted acreage, plant schedules, storage inventories, spot availability, quality, and substitute varieties.

Procurement teams can see whether an Agria premium is supported by broad competition for suitable tonnes or by a localized quality problem. Growers can compare contract interest with likely market absorption. Operations can evaluate whether Markies, Innovator, Challenger, or another approved variety can substitute without hurting recovery or customer specifications. Finance can model the cost of limited variety flexibility.

Use Case

A European fry processor receives a sharp Agria increase after poor late-storage quality in one basin. MassGain shows two neighboring regions still have approved Agria lots and that Markies can cover one standard-cut line. Procurement limits the premium to the truly constrained product and shifts flexible volume elsewhere.

FAQs

Why do processors value Agria potatoes?

Dry matter, fry color, shape, recovery, storage performance, and established customer specifications support demand.

Can other varieties replace Agria?

Sometimes, but plant settings, finished quality, yield, customer approval, and storage condition determine suitability.
